Hey guys, if you've done any advertising work in the past, could you tell me if this'll work? I reckon it has potential.

Basically advertise Dentist and Doctors offices, here's how I'd do it:

1 - Pick myself a city, state etc to target and gather a list of the dentist and doctors offices that are located in that location including and gather their physical addresses and site URL's.

2 - Register a domain name with the name of that city in the domain name. For example if you're targeting Dentist Offices in NY you should register something like DentistsInNY.com or NYDentistOffice.com.

3 - Purchase Hosting and install WordPress onto the domain and publish a "Reviews" related theme on the site.

4 -Send an email to all of the dentist offices in that location letting them know that you can offer them a permanent advertising listing spot on your site for only $100 and that there's only 5 spots available on your site. By only offering 5 spots per site your prospects will have a feeling of exclusivity and for $200 they can't afford not to purchase it. Let them know that you'll also be writing a positive 500+ word post on their office that will be posted along with their contact information and site URL so visitors and users looking for Dental Care can easily be contact them. Also, you'll want to create a page on your site and set the URL up like NewYorkDentistOffices.com/pay = so it will look more professional if and when they decide to purchase.

5 - Enjoy the earnings


I reckon if I can get about 50 dentists at least 10 will pay. Don't forget, Dentists make a heck of a lot of $ and can spend thousands on advertisements. I'll most likely try for $100 a listing and advertisement, however. It could be reoccurring each month, and to get them that final push to join, do deals such as buy 12 months worth (lets say $100 each month = $1,200) get two months free (so $1000 in total)

In all, the cost of setting up the website will be next to none. WordPress themes are usually free, and domain names are cheap as chips.

Theoretically, this could work wonders on a range of services. Restaurants, Plumbers, technicians, IT support, Dog walkers, gardeners, Lawyers...So the potential is high. I could also (for say, Dog walkers) lower the price to $30-50 a month as they'll earn a lot less per day than a Dentist.

I'd also try to rank the website for a keyword. Lets say dentists: "Dentists in New York" or..."Lawyers in Baltimore.



Would this possibly work? Or am I having a pipe dream?

  • It can certainly be a good idea if you are able to get the dentists to sign up for the service. You'll need a professional/convincing way to reach out to them and get them to agree to pay you.

    You might even consider doing something like "NYServiceReviews.com" and then add on /dentists for the dental side, /lawyers for lawyers and so on. That way you have fewer expenses, and also you may be able to position yourself as an authority in that particular city.

    Also, i'd start with medium sized cities rather than New York.

      You will need massive traffic to justify asking $200 for a listing and $100 a month in advertising. And big traffic costs big money, or years of work if you don't want to pay.

      Also, 10 sales in 50 (20%), not a chance, ever. When you eventually get good at internet marketing you'll be doing well to consistently deliver one tenth of that.

      There are dozens of listings sites that businesses of all types in any city can get onto, often for free.Your potential clients will already be on many of them. You have to ask yourself why would anyone want to pay you?

      Your idea is do-able, but you will need to address all of these issues, and many more, to stand any chance of success. Sorry to be tough, but no-one is giving you a wake-up call on here yet.
